    Obstetrics & Gynaecology Nursing Officer

    Roles and Responsibilities

    Care and Coordination

    • Providing nursing care to patients in an outpatient gynecology setting, including triage, assessment, vaccination, family planning, phlebotomy and other procedures.
    • Administering medications to patients and monitoring them for side effects and reactions.
    • Monitoring, reporting, and recording symptoms or changes in patient conditions.
    • Collaborating with the healthcare team to coordinate patient care and ensure continuity.
    • Ordering medical diagnostic and clinical tests as guided by the physician on duty.
    • Assist physicians during examinations, procedures, and treatments, ensuring patient comfort and safety.
    • Modifying patient health treatment plans as indicated by patient conditions and responses.
    • Give clients health education and advice on health matters as per Ministry of Health and International guidelines.
    • Ensure that excellent customer service is delivered to patients through excellent communication, timely treatment plans and patient referral and professional care
    • Efficiently collaborate with logistics team during deployment for healthcare services as required.
    • Conduct emergency care as and when deemed necessary. 
    • Administrative duties in the clinic as advised by your supervisor.

    Quality

    • Work with your supervisor to develop and implement relevant healthcare guidelines, standard operational procedures and policies and recommend improvements and adjustments where necessary.
    • Deliver quality and complete assignments with clear documentation.
    • Maintain accurate, complete health care records and reports as per the Ministry of Health and regulatory bodies.

    Skills: 

    • Communication skills, including sensitivity and the ability to provide clear explanations.
    • Ability to spot and solve problems, requiring effective decision-making skills.
    •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ment.
    • Business management skills.
    • Ability to work efficiently and independently.
    • Organizational ability.
    • Attention to detail.

    Requirements:

    • Diploma or degree in Nursing.
    • At least 3 years post internship experience in a clinical setting with experience in gynaecology or women’s health.
    • Proficiency in electronic medical records (EMR) systems.
    • ACLS/BLS/EMONC certification (desirable).
    • Must have working computer skills including MS Word and Excel.
    • Certificate of Registration from the respective professional regulatory body. 
    • Valid Professional Practice License.
